PhpMyAdmin\Plugins\AuthenticationPlugin S

Total Complexity 49
Dependencies 11
Dependents 2
Total lines 323
Lines of code 164
Logical lines of code 95
Comment lines 92
Methods 14
Properties 4

Methods 14

Method Rating Maintainability Complexity Lines of code
checkRules()
A
46 16 38
logOut()
A
48 8 31
getErrorMessage()
S
52 7 25
checkTwoFactor()
S
52 5 26
setSessionAccessTime()
S
59 3 13
authenticate()
S
65 2 10
__construct()
S
76 1 4
showLoginForm()
S
100 1 0
readCredentials()
S
100 1 0
storeCredentials()
S
68 1 7
rememberCredentials()
S
91 1 2
showFailure()
S
80 1 3
getLoginFormURL()
S
82 1 3
handlePasswordChange()
S
91 1 2